About the Upper Franklin Canyon Loop trail
At 1 miles with 180 feet of elevation gain, Upper Franklin Canyon Loop runs as a loop through Southern California, from 869 feet at its lowest to 1,025 feet at its highest. The steepest pitch reaches 43 percent, against an average of 180 feet of gain per mile. On our gain-and-distance scale it falls in the easiest band. The nearest town is Burbank, 7 miles away.
The area
Franklin Canyon Park is a public municipal park located between Benedict Canyon and Coldwater Canyon, at the eastern end of the Santa Monica Mountains, in Los Angeles, California. The park comprises 605 acres (245 ha), and is located near the geographical center of the city of Los Angeles.
